Oversee and supervise Safety Aides at a family shelter facility, ensuring compliance with security and FDNY protocols. Train staff on procedures, equipment use, workshops, and incident report writing. Maintain critical files, provide administrative oversight, monitor surveillance systems, and respond to emergencies. The role requires NYS security licensing, F-02, F-80, and T-89 FLSD certifications, plus at least five years of relevant experience including supervisory experience.
